Position: Institutional Sales & Service Associate - Contractor Duration: 12 month assignment (High possibility of extension) Client Location: Hybrid - 4 days a week to office Pay rate: $30-32/hr T4 About our client Our client offers Canadian investors information and insight, along with a wide range of funds, investment trusts, ETFs and investment solutions. About this opportunity: The Institutional Sales & Service team supports clients across the Institutional and strategic relationship and distribution channels throughout the full client lifecycle. The group partners closely with Sales and Relationship Managers to deliver responsive, high-quality service that strengthens client relationships and supports long-term asset retention. Team members work collaboratively across functions, delivering service excellence with efficiency in a fast-paced, client-facing environment. HOW YOU WILL ADD VALUE Core Responsibilities You will deliver consistent, high-quality service to institutional clients. You will respond to client inquiries and service requests promptly. You will resolve issues by partnering with internal teams. You will maintain strong, ongoing client relationships. You will support asset retention through effective servicing. Operational & Coordination Responsibilities You will manage client deliverables and presentation materials. You will ensure timelines and deadlines are consistently met. You will coordinate requests for proposals (RFPs) and due diligence questionnaires (DDQs). You will ensure responses are accurate and submitted on time. You will address account-related issues through cross-functional coordination. Strategic & Compliance Support You will partner with Sales and Relationship Managers to support business goals. You will maintain accurate client records in customer relationship management systems. You will support compliance reviews and regulatory requirements. You will contribute to special projects and initiatives as needed. WHAT WILL HELP YOU BE SUCCESSFUL IN THIS ROLE Experience, Education & Certifications University degree or equivalent relevant financial services industry experience. 5 years’ experience in the fund manager, bank, or securities industry essential; prior knowledge of investment management processes from a servicing or operational perspective preferred. Fluency in English – spoken and written, is essential. French fluency is a plus. Canadian Securities Course preferred. Technical Skills Proficiency with Microsoft PowerPoint, Excel, and Word. Soft Skills A sales/ marketing mindset with the ability to identify client needs and position solutions that address those needs. Strong multi-tasker who can respond rapidly and effectively to requests, with adherence to established time frames and schedules; ability to organize and prioritize workflow to meet internal and external deadlines. Strong written and verbal communication skills. Ability to work independently and collaboratively. High attention to detail and confidentiality.
